第6章 数据库管理系统Access 2003 1. 数据管理技术经历了:人工管理、文件系统、数据库系统三个阶段。 人工管理阶段特点:①数据不保存②数据没有软件系统管理,由应用程序管理③数据不共享④数据不独立 文件系统阶段缺点:①编程不方便②冗余量大③数据独立性不好④不支持并发访问⑤数据缺少统一管理 数据库系统的特点:①数据结构化②数据共享性高,冗余度低,易扩充③数据独立性高④数据由数据库管理系统统一管理和控制 2. 数据库的基本概念 数据(Data)是描述事物的符号记录,是数据库中存储的基本对象。 数据库(DataBase,简称DB)是指长期储存在计算机内的、有组织的、可共享的数据集合。 数据库管理系统(DataBase Management System,简称DBMS)是完成科学地组织数据和存储数据, 并高效地获取和维护数据任务的一个系统软件,是位于用户和操作系统之间的一层数据管理软件。 主要功能:①数据定义功能②数据操纵功能③数据库的运行管理 ④数据库的建立和维护功能 (目前,常用的小型数据管理系统主要有Access、VFP、Foxbase、Approach、dBase等) 数据库系统(简称DBS)由数据库、数据库管理系统、应用系统、数据库管理员和用户构成,是指在计算机系统中引入数据库后的系统 3.数据模型 根据模型应用的目的不同,可以将这些模型划分为两类,它们分属于两个不同的层次。 1)第一类是概念模型(也称信息模型),是按用户的观点来对数据和信息建模,主要用于数据库设计。 2)另一类是数据模型,主要包括网状模型、层次模型、关系模型,主要用于DBMS的实现。 关系模型:关系模型把世界看作是由实体(Entity)和联系(Relationship)构成的。 ①实体是指现实世界中具有区别于其他事物的特征或属性并与其他实体有联系的对象。 ②联系是指实体之间的关系,即实体之间的对应关系。联系可分:一对一联系、一对多联系、多对多联系 关系模型的基本概念: 关系:一个关系就是一张二维表,每个关系有一个关系名。 属性:二维表中的列被称为属性,每个属性有唯一的属性名,属性被称为字段,属性名叫做字段名 域:一个属性的取值范围叫做一个域。 元组:二维表每个水平方向的行称为一个元组,又被称为记录。 码:又称关键字、主键。 分量:每个元组的一个属性值叫做该元组的一个分量。 关系模式:是对关系的描述,它包括关系名、组成该关系的属性名、属性到域的映像。简称为关系名。 关系运算:选择,在一个关系中选择满足条件的元组; 投影,在一个关系中选择满足条件的属性; 连接,在两个关系的笛卡尔积中选取属性间满足一定条件的元组。 4.Access 2003数据库的对象 七种对象:表、查询、窗体、报表、页、宏、模块 1)表(Table):是数据库的最基本对象处于核心地位,表由记录组成,记录由字段组成,表用来存贮数据库的数据,故又称数据表。 2)查询(Query):查询可以按索引快速查找到需要的记录 3)窗体(Form):窗体也称表单,它提供了一种方便的浏览、输入及更改数据的窗口。 4)报表(Report):报表的功能是将数据库中的数据分类汇总,然后打印出来,以便分析。 5)页(WebPage,也称Web页,访问页):访问页是一种特殊类型的Web页,用户可以在此Web页中查看、修改Access数据库中的数据。 6)宏(Macro):宏相当于DOS中的批处理,用来自动执行一系列操作。 7)模块(Module): 模块的功能与宏类似,但它定义的操作比宏更精细和复杂,用户可以根据自己的需要编写程序。模块使用Visual Basic编程。 本文转载于微信公众号: 山东专升本咨询平台(skyzsb1997),更多微信文章请扫描关注公众号: |
|
声明:文章版权归原作者所有 部分文章转自互联网 如有侵权请联系
[邮箱地址] 删除
|